Analysis

UNICEF: Middle East and North Africa recorded 47.9% for adjusted net enrolment rate, one year before the official primary in 2024. That is the highest value across all 27 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 3.7% on the previous year and up 17.0% over ten years.

Over the whole period, adjusted net enrolment rate, one year before the official primary in UNICEF: Middle East and North Africa peaked at 47.9% in 2024 and was at its lowest, 25.8%, in 2003.

UNICEF: Middle East and North Africa ranks 185th of 217 groups on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 27 years of available data.

Adjusted net enrolment rate, one year before the official primary in UNICEF: Middle East and North Africa, year by year

Annual values for Adjusted net enrolment rate, one year before the official primary entry age, female (%) in UNICEF: Middle East and North Africa, 1998 to 2024.
Year % Change
1998 31.2%
1999 29.6% -5.1%
2000 28.8% -2.8%
2001 27.4% -5.0%
2002 26.4% -3.5%
2003 25.8% -2.6%
2004 26.8% +4.1%
2005 27.8% +3.6%
2006 31.3% +12.8%
2007 32.3% +3.2%
2008 32.8% +1.4%
2009 35.9% +9.4%
2010 36.3% +1.3%
2011 38.0% +4.6%
2012 39.3% +3.3%
2013 38.9% -0.9%
2014 40.9% +5.1%
2015 41.2% +0.7%
2016 41.5% +0.8%
2017 42.7% +2.8%
2018 43.5% +1.9%
2019 45.1% +3.8%
2020 45.9% +1.7%
2021 42.8% -6.7%
2022 45.6% +6.6%
2023 46.1% +1.1%
2024 47.9% +3.7%
